Brian is Board-certified as a Medical Malpractice attorney by the ABPLA. Board-certification is rare and prestigious, including because it is only awarded only after having your trial experience vetted and passing an extensive exam.
He has been selected by SuperLawyers for 11 consecutive years as a plaintiffs’ attorney handling medical malpractice and personal injury cases (2015-2025).
Brian has the highest rating available for attorneys from Martindale-Hubbell – AV Preeminent. The AV rating means a lawyer’s peers (attorneys/judges) rank him at the highest level of professional excellence. He also has the highest rating possible with Avvo-a 10.0 / Superb rating.
Brian is licensed to practice law in Hawaii, California, Tennessee, Georgia, and Florida, and he is admitted to practice before the United States Supreme Court, and the United States District Courts in Hawaii and in Tennessee.
